Embodiment 1

[0031] The positive electrode waste collected in the production of lithium iron phosphate batteries is crushed with a crusher, and the particle size of the crushed electrode pieces is controlled at 0.5-3cm. The broken positive electrode fragments were placed in a muffle furnace under nitrogen protection, and heat-treated at a temperature of 600° C. for 8 hrs to decompose the binder in the electrode piece. Use a vibrating sieve to sieve the heat-treated positive electrode waste. The undersieve is the mixture of lithium iron phosphate cathode material, conductive agent, and binder residue. The oversieve is aluminum foil, positive electrode material lumps and still The positive electrode material attached to the surface of the aluminum foil. Abstract

The invention relates to a synthesized recovery method for waste positive plates of iron phosphate lithium batteries. The method comprises the following steps: collected waste positive plate material is mechanically crashed into fragments; the fragments are positioned in a welding furnace which is protected by vacuum atmosphere, inert gases and/or reducing gases and/or nitrogen and are heat processed in the temperature of 150-750 DEG C; aluminum foil basal bodies are separated from the fragments after heat process by adopting mechanical separation or ultrasonic concussion to obtain a mixture of iron phosphate lithium positive material, conduction agent and caking agent giblets; the mixture of iron phosphate lithium anode material, conduction agent and caking agent giblets is roasted for 8-24 hrs in 80-150 DRG C; the mixture after roasting is classified to control the grain diameter of the powder material to be not more than 20 microns, and the D50 is controlled to be 3-10 microns so as to obtain iron phosphate lithium positive recovery material. The method has simple technique, takes effect fast and reduces the material consumption and production cost of a manufacturer.

【Technical field】 [0001] The invention relates to a battery material recovery method, in particular to a comprehensive recovery method for lithium iron phosphate battery positive electrode waste. 【Background technique】 [0002] With the rapid development of electronic technology, lithium batteries that provide power for various portable electronic products are increasingly widely used. At present, lithium batteries have replaced nickel-cadmium batteries and nickel-metal hydride batteries in the field of small secondary batteries and become the mainstream of commercial secondary batteries. . With the continuous growth of lithium battery consumption, more and more scraps and scraps are generated in the manufacturing process of lithium batteries. Many lithium battery manufacturers and waste treatment units have only stopped dealing with such industrial waste at present.
